Hey just wondering if anyone's done it, or know how hard it could be?
Changing a factory 2T-GEU car to a 3T-GTEU. i.e TA61 Carina.
What changes would have to be made?

Brakes, computer, ignition, exhaust, gearbox, driveshaft, diff and maybe radiator. Thats about it, if keeping the motor standard the diff won't need changing but winding up the boost will shorten its life quickly.

don't forget the 3tgteu have got a seperate knock control ecu thing.
I think the radiator have the same inlet outlet side.. but u might want a bigger one for the 3tgteu.
